This analysis examines how Infosys is leveraging cloud-native architectures and AI synergies to drive strategic growth in regions where digital banking adoption is accelerating.Emerging markets are at the forefront of a banking revolution, driven by the need for cost-effective, flexible, and real-time financial services. According to a report by Custom Market Insights, cloud-native solutions are central to this shift, enabling banks to replace legacy systems with modular, agile platforms that support fintech integration and regulatory compliance [1]. Infosys’ Edgeverve Systems and Finacle division have become key enablers of this transition, offering platforms that reduce infrastructure costs by 30–50% while enhancing operational resilience [4].
The Asia-Pacific region, in particular, is a growth engine. Initiatives like India’s Gati Shakti and Singapore’s Smart Nation are accelerating cloud-first policies, while the BRICS+ digital cooperation is reducing reliance on U.S. cloud providers [2]. This aligns with Infosys’ expansion in the region, where it has partnered with institutions like DBS Bank to modernize core banking systems and enable real-time customer insights [5].
Infosys’ success in emerging markets is underpinned by strategic alliances that combine cloud-native infrastructure with AI capabilities. For instance, its collaboration with DNB Bank ASA in Norway involves modernizing IT systems using AI and machine learning to deliver personalized services [4]. Similarly, the partnership with
to integrate cross-border payment solutions via Infosys Finacle highlights the company’s ability to address global financial needs while adhering to local market demands [4].AI integration is a cornerstone of these efforts. A notable example is a UAE-based digital bank that partnered with Infosys Finacle to build a cloud-native platform powered by AI and blockchain. This solution enabled the bank to serve corporate and personal wealth clients with secure, scalable services, including virtual accounts and digital lending [3]. In Latin America, Bancolombia and Nequi leveraged Finacle to modernize offshore operations and drive crypto adoption, demonstrating the adaptability of Infosys’ solutions to regional financial ecosystems [5].
The financial benefits of Infosys’ cloud-native and AI strategies are substantial. By automating processes and reducing manual effort—such as a credit card company achieving a 50% reduction in operational tasks—Infosys helps clients improve efficiency and scalability [6]. Additionally, the company’s investment in reskilling 275,000 employees in AI-related domains and developing small language models underscores its commitment to maintaining a competitive edge [7].
Emerging markets are also reaping the rewards. In Africa, the Co-operative Bank of Kenya adopted Finacle to accelerate regional growth, while DBS Bank’s Digibank in India used AI-driven digital engagement tools to enhance customer experiences [5]. These cases illustrate how Infosys’ solutions address both macroeconomic trends (e.g., digital inclusion) and microeconomic needs (e.g., cost optimization).
